How the Internet of Things Works—Simply Explained
At its core, the Internet of Things connects physical devices to the internet, allowing them to collect, share, and act on data automatically. Sensors embedded in everyday objects—from kitchen appliances to industrial machinery—capture real-time information and send it to cloud platforms. These systems process the data using advanced analytics, then trigger responses like adjusting temperature, sending alerts, or optimizing operations. Users interact through mobile apps or voice assistants, creating a seamless loop of detection, communication, and action. Unlike traditional systems, IoT devices learn and adapt, improving performance over time. This integration reduces manual input and enhances efficiency across homes, workplaces, and public infrastructure.
Common Questions About the Internet of Things
How secure is IoT technology?
Data privacy and cybersecurity remain top concerns. Most reputable IoT systems use encrypted communication and regular software updates to protect user information. Can I control IoT devices from anywhere?
Yes, most devices connect via secure mobile apps or web portals, enabling remote monitoring and control. However, reliable internet access is essential, especially in areas with limited connectivity. Mobile-first design ensures accessibility, even when on the go.
Do IoT devices work together across brands?
Interoperability varies. While major platforms support broader integration, many systems use proprietary protocols—users should research compatibility before purchasing. The industry is moving toward open standards, but users often benefit from choosing devices within a consistent ecosystem.
What are the long-term benefits of IoT?
Economically, IoT drives efficiency in energy use, operational costs, and productivity. Environmentally, smart sensors help reduce waste and emissions. For individuals, connected health monitors and home automation improve convenience and wellness. These advantages are reshaping expectations around what technology can deliver.
Misconceptions About the Internet of Things
One frequent myth is that IoT devices constantly spy on users. In reality, data collection is selective and usually limited to sensor input, with strict privacy safeguards in place. Another misunderstanding is that IoT is too complex for average users. In truth, modern interfaces are designed for simplicity, reducing barriers to adoption. Some fear obsolescence from rapid hardware updates, but many devices are built for longevity and software support. Understanding these realities helps users engage intelligently with the ecosystem.
